In most cases, sinus infections will go away within a few weeks, andantibiotics may not be necessary.

A Z-Pak is a five-day course ofazithromycinthat has been a common antibiotic for sinus infections.

Azithromycin is in the class of antibiotics known as macrolides.

Can a Z-Pak Treat a Sinus Infection?

Yes, a Z-Pak can be an effective treatment for bacterial sinus infections.

However, it is ineffective against viral sinus infections, which account for most sinus infections.

Moreover, a Z-Pak is no longer the recommended go-to antibiotic due to the risk of resistance.

It is crucial to see a healthcare provider to get a diagnosis.

Your healthcare provider will be able to determine whether a bacterium or virus is causing your infection.
